KU59 YDP is a 2009 Honda Vfr 800 A-9 in Red with a 782c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.
Across all 2009 Honda Vfr 800 A-9 models, the average MOT pass rate is 88.9% with a typical mileage of 14,567 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Honda Vfr 800 A-9 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th is below minimum requirements of 1.0mm, accounting for 29 recorded failures. If you're considering buying KU59 YDP,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Honda Vfr 800 A-9 typically stays on UK roads for around 17 years. At 17 years old, this Honda Vfr 800 A-9 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
